New York Knicks 113, Charlotte Bobcats 89

The Bobcats were awful last night as they let the Knicks shoot 51.1% from the floor and that was the biggest reason for the loss. Matt Carroll led the way for the Bobcats with 19 points and 4 rebounds. Emeka Okafor was only 5 of 15 from the floor but he still finished with 18 points, 14 rebounds and 2 blocked shots. Raymond Felton pitched in with 14 points, 4 rebounds and 5 assists. The Bobcats are now 19-38 on the season.

Washington Wizards 110, Charlotte Bobcats 95

The Bobcats were outrebounded 46-36 on Saturday Night and they were outscored 59-43 in the 2nd half and those were the big reasons for the loss. Jason Richardson led the way for the Bobcats with 25 points and 5 rebounds. Emeka Okafor was solid around the basket with 17 points and 13 rebounds. Jeff McInnis pitched in with 12 points, 2 rebounds and 3 assists. The Bobcats are now 19-37 on the season.

Sacramento Kings 116, Charlotte Bobcats 115 in OT

The Bobcats were outrebounded 52-43 in this game and it killed them in the end. Jason Richardson led the way for the Bobcats in this game with 29 points, 5 rebounds, 2 steals and 2 blocked shots. Raymond Felton did a decent job of running the offense with 17 points, 7 rebounds, 10 assists and 3 steals. Derek Anderson pitched in with 15 points, 4 rebounds and 2 steals on the bench. The Bobcats are now 19-36 on the season.

San Antonio Spurs 85, Charlotte Bobcats 65

The Bobcats only shot 28.2% from the floor on Tuesday Night and they were outrebounded 54-38 which explains the final score. Raymond Felton led the way for the Bobcats with 19 points, 4 rebounds and 4 assists. Jason Richardson was only 4 of 11 from the floor but he still finished with 13 points, 2 rebounds, 4 assists and 2 steals. Nazr Mohammed scored 12 points, grabbed 6 rebounds and stole the ball twice off the bench. The Bobcats are now 19-35 on the season.

Charlotte Bobcats 100, Atlanta Hawks 98

The Bobcats outscored the Hawks 29-19 in the 4th quarter to pull out a nice home win on Wednesday Night. Raymond Felton did a solid job of running the offense as he finished up with 22 points, 4 rebounds and 7 assists. Emeka Okafor was dominating in the middle with 20 points, 21 rebounds and 5 blocked shots. Jason Richardson only shot 6 of 17 from the floor but he still finished with 19 points, 8 rebounds, 3 assists and 2 steals. The Bobcats are now 19-34 on the season.
